Woman mirrors her son’s tantrum behaviours in the store

by Johana Mukandila
Picture: TikTok

Most parents have to deal with their little one’s negging on a daily basis which they don’t really complain about. However, it gets frustrating for parents when their little ones do not know how to behave in public and throw unnecessary tantrums, which can sometimes be embarrassing for the parents. 

However, one particular woman placed Mzansi into a media frenzy after she went viral for teaching her son a valuable lesson about his embarrassing behaviours in public. 

In the video posted on Tik-Tok by @thoanie9410, a woman mirrors her son’s public outburst of anger and throws a massive tantrum at the grocery store.

While the mom fell down to the ground to showcase her son tantrum she said:

“Oh yeah stop embarrassing me,” she told the little boy.

The little boy was surprised by his mother’s behaviours and stood in awe watching his mom with his arms folded.

The video has gained over 2.4 million views, along with thousands of likes and comments.

Many of the mothers on social media jumped into the comment section as they could relate to her frustrations and applauded her for giving the boy a taste of his own medicine.
